helps to develop
Grammar usage guide and real-world examplesUSAGE SUMMARY
The part of the sentence "helps to develop" is correct and usable in written English.
You can use it to indicate that something is assisting in the development of something else. For example: "Using a structured approach to learning the language helps to develop a strong foundation in the language."

Expert writing Tips
Best practice
When using "helps to develop", ensure that the subject clearly indicates what is providing the assistance and that the object clearly states what is being developed. For example, "Consistent practice helps to develop strong problem-solving skills."
Common error
Avoid vague statements where it is unclear what is actually contributing to the development. Instead of saying "This helps to develop...", specify the active agent: "This strategy helps educators to develop more effective teaching methods."

Linguistic Context
The phrase "helps to develop" functions as a verb phrase indicating assistance in a process of growth or advancement. It connects a subject that provides aid with an object that is being improved or expanded. As Ludwig AI shows, this phrase is widely accepted and frequently used across various contexts.

More alternative expressions(10)
Phrases that express similar concepts, ordered by semantic similarity:
assists in developing
Changes the verb from "helps" to "assists", implying a more supportive role.
facilitates the development of
Replaces "helps" with "facilitates", highlighting the ease or smoothness of the developmental process and adds "of".
contributes to the development of
Emphasizes the contribution towards the development, focusing on the impact.
aids in the development of
Uses "aids" to show support or assistance during the development process and adds "of".
supports the development of
Focuses on providing support or backing for the development, ensuring stability and progress and adds "of".
promotes the development of
Highlights the action of encouraging or furthering the development and adds "of".
fosters the development of
Suggests nurturing and encouraging the growth or progress of something and adds "of".
enables the development of
Focuses on making the development possible, highlighting the creation of opportunities and adds "of".
plays a role in developing
Indicates involvement or influence in the developmental process; less direct than "helps".
is instrumental in developing
Emphasizes the critical importance of something in the development process.
FAQs
How can I use "helps to develop" in a sentence?
Use "helps to develop" to show that something aids in the growth or improvement of something else. For instance, "Reading regularly "helps to develop" vocabulary".
What are some alternatives to "helps to develop"?
You can use alternatives like "assists in developing", "facilitates the development of", or "contributes to the development of" depending on the specific context.
Which is more appropriate, "helps to develop" or "helps in developing"?
Both "helps to develop" and "helps in developing" are grammatically correct, but "helps to develop" is generally more common and preferred. "Helps in developing" emphasizes the process more directly.
How does "helps to develop" differ from "is essential for developing"?
"Helps to develop" indicates assistance, while "is essential for developing" implies necessity. The latter suggests that something is indispensable for the development, while the former suggests that something merely aids it. For example: "Experience "helps to develop" skills", vs "Training is essential for developing competence".
